Picchetti Heraldry: The Coat of Arms and Family Origins

The surname Picchetti has a rich history, with origins dating back to the medieval period. It is believed to stem from the medieval given name Pichettus, as evidenced by records from the Fabbrica del Duomo in Florence from the year 1416.

Alternatively, the surname could also derive from nicknames attributed to ancestors who carried a pike, a medieval weapon also known as a "picchetto". This connection to a specific weapon suggests a noble lineage with a martial background.

Throughout history, the Picchetti family has developed various branches in different regions of Italy. These include areas such as Verbanese and Varese, Bergamo, Veneto and Treviso, Pisa, Ravenna, Forlì, and the Roman territory. Each branch may have distinct characteristics and histories that have contributed to the diversity of the surname.

While Picchetti is the more common variation of the surname, there is also a rarer form known as Picchetto, primarily found in regions like Liguria and Latium. Despite its less frequent occurrence, the Picchetto branch likely has its own unique heritage and traditions passed down through the generations.
